Subject: 24.0.50; doc strings of region-beginning, region-end
Date: Tue, 22 Jun 2010 09:13:10 -0700
The doc strings just repeat the function names - they provide no helpful
info at all.
 
What we need to add is what is said in the Elisp manual: that the
"beginning" ("end") is the position of either point or the mark,
whichever is smaller (larger).
